Community TutorIn a lesson about phrasal verbs, my student and I discovered several in Queen songs!
"If I'm not back again this time tomorrow- carry on, carry on!" (from Bohemian Rhapsody)
"The show must go on!" (from The Show Must Go On 😂)
Both of these phrasal verbs, "to carry on" and "to go on", often have the same meaning. Do you know what they mean?
Have you heard any other phrasal verbs in other songs?
